With Bitly, you can track how many clicks your shortened links receive, plus bookmark and organize your links on your own personalized Bitly dashboard. A real-time dashboard with traffic analytics and referrer data shows how many people shared and clicked your links. bit.ly is a free service. From Google Event Tracking Guide Event Tracking is a method available in the ga.js tracking code that you can use to record user interaction with website elements, such as a Flash-driven menu system.
